apple greens
PREPARATION + COOKING 5 + 12 minutes S T O R AG E Let cool, then cover and refrigerate for up to 2 days, or freeze for up to 1 month. Apples p rovide a good sourc e of pectin , a form o f soluble fiber that can h elp eliminate toxins from your baby's body, as well as feed your baby's friendly gut bacteria.

When it comes to the best starter foods for your baby, you can't go wrong with apple puree - its sweetness is virtually a guaranteed winner with all first-fooders. This version of pureed apple includes a little "green" powder, in the form of powdered spirulina or wheatgrass, which is a fantastically easy way to boost the nutritional content of the puree.

1 Steam the apple for 10 minutes until tender. 2 Put the apple in a blender or food processor with the green superfood powder and 1-2 tablespoons once-boiled water. Process until smooth. For an even smoother puree, push the blended apple and green superfood mixture through a fine strainer.
